轻量云服务器能干嘛,轻量云服务器可以安装几个网站软件
- 综合资讯
- 2024-09-30 07:54:30
- 5

***:本文主要涉及轻量云服务器相关问题,一是轻量云服务器的功能用途,二是其可安装网站软件的数量。这两个方面反映出人们对轻量云服务器的基本关注内容,前者关系到其在实际应...
***:本文主要探讨轻量云服务器的功能以及可安装网站软件数量的问题。轻量云服务器具有多种功能,例如为企业或个人提供计算资源,可用于搭建网站、运行应用程序等。然而关于其能安装几个网站软件,受到多种因素的影响,像服务器的配置(包括内存、存储空间等)、网站软件的资源占用情况、运行环境需求等,没有一个固定的数量标准。
《轻量云服务器安装网站软件的数量及功能全解析》
一、轻量云服务器简介
轻量云服务器是一种新型的云计算服务产品,它融合了云计算的高性能、高可靠性和简易性等多种优势,相较于传统的云服务器,轻量云服务器具有成本低、操作简单等特点,非常适合中小企业、创业公司以及个人开发者。
二、轻量云服务器能安装网站软件的相关因素
1、资源配置
- 轻量云服务器的资源配置主要包括CPU、内存、存储和带宽等方面,不同的配置对于安装网站软件的数量有着直接的影响,一个具有1核CPU、1GB内存和20GB存储的轻量云服务器,与2核CPU、4GB内存和50GB存储的服务器相比,能够承载的网站软件数量和运行效率会有很大差异。
- 如果服务器资源有限,安装过多的网站软件可能会导致服务器性能下降,出现响应缓慢甚至崩溃的情况,资源较少的轻量云服务器可能适合安装1 - 3个简单的小型网站软件,如个人博客系统,而配置较高的轻量云服务器,如具有4核CPU、8GB内存等资源的,可以安装5 - 10个甚至更多的网站软件,当然这还取决于网站软件的复杂程度和流量需求。
2、操作系统兼容性
- 轻量云服务器支持多种操作系统,如Linux(Ubuntu、CentOS等)和Windows Server等,不同的网站软件对操作系统有不同的要求,WordPress这个非常流行的网站内容管理系统,在Linux系统下安装和运行较为稳定,并且对资源的占用相对合理。
- 如果选择Windows Server操作系统的轻量云服务器,一些基于.NET框架开发的网站软件可能会更容易安装和部署,但Windows系统本身相对Linux系统在资源占用上可能会更高一些,所以在考虑安装网站软件数量时,操作系统的选择也是一个重要因素,如果选择的操作系统能够更好地兼容网站软件,在资源允许的情况下,可以安装更多的软件。
3、网站软件的类型和需求
- 不同类型的网站软件在资源需求上差异很大,静态网站生成器,如Hugo或Jekyll,它们对服务器资源的需求相对较低,这类软件主要是将预先生成好的静态页面提供给用户,不需要复杂的服务器端脚本处理,所以在轻量云服务器上,可以同时安装多个这样的静态网站软件。
- 而动态网站软件,如基于PHP + MySQL的电商平台系统(如Magento)或者大型的企业级内容管理系统(如Drupal),它们需要服务器提供数据库支持、脚本解析等功能,对CPU、内存和数据库资源的需求较高,一个配置不是特别高的轻量云服务器可能只能安装1 - 2个这样的大型动态网站软件。
三、实际安装数量示例与分析
1、小型企业场景
- 假设一个小型企业使用轻量云服务器来搭建企业网站、企业博客和一个简单的产品展示网站,如果选择了一个中等配置的轻量云服务器,例如2核CPU、4GB内存和30GB存储的Linux服务器,企业网站使用WordPress搭建,企业博客使用Typecho,产品展示网站使用一个简单的自定义HTML + CSS + JavaScript的静态网站框架。
- 在这种情况下,由于WordPress和Typecho对资源的需求相对适中,并且静态网站几乎不占用太多动态资源,这个轻量云服务器完全可以轻松承载这三个网站软件,还可以预留一定的资源用于应对网站流量的波动和未来可能的功能扩展。
2、个人开发者场景
- 一个个人开发者可能想要在轻量云服务器上测试多个自己开发的小型项目,他开发了两个基于Node.js的小型Web应用、一个基于Python Flask的API服务和一个使用Ruby on Rails搭建的简单博客系统,如果他使用的是一个1核CPU、2GB内存和20GB存储的轻量云服务器,在开发测试阶段,这些软件可以同时安装在服务器上。
- 当这些项目需要面向用户进行实际的小规模运行时,可能需要根据实际的流量和性能情况,对服务器资源进行优化调整,或者考虑升级服务器配置以确保所有项目的稳定运行。
四、优化安装以提高数量和性能
1、资源优化
- 通过合理配置服务器的资源分配,可以提高能够安装的网站软件数量,对于数据库资源,可以使用数据库优化工具来调整数据库的缓存、索引等参数,以提高数据库的查询效率,从而减少对服务器整体资源的占用。
- 在内存管理方面,可以根据网站软件的需求,调整服务器的内存分配策略,对于一些不经常使用的服务,可以设置定时启动和关闭,释放内存资源供其他重要的网站软件使用。
2、软件优化
- 对网站软件本身进行优化也至关重要,对于一些开源的网站软件,可以根据自己的需求定制化编译,去除一些不必要的功能模块,以减少软件的资源占用,在编译安装PHP时,可以只选择实际项目中需要用到的扩展,而不是安装所有的默认扩展。
- 对网站的前端代码进行优化,如压缩CSS和JavaScript文件、优化图片资源等,可以减少服务器的带宽占用,从而间接提高服务器能够承载的网站软件数量。
轻量云服务器能够安装的网站软件数量不是一个固定的值,而是受到多种因素的综合影响,在实际应用中,需要根据服务器的资源配置、操作系统、网站软件类型和需求等多方面因素进行权衡和优化,以达到最佳的使用效果。
本文链接:https://www.zhitaoyun.cn/82505.html
发表评论